Peters's Ghost-faced Bat vs Slender Ground-hopper

Mormoops megalophylla compared with Tetrix subulata

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Peters's Ghost-faced Bat Slender Ground-hopper
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Orthoptera (Orthoptera)
Family Mormoopidae Tetrigidae
Genus Mormoops Tetrix
Species Mormoops megalophylla Tetrix subulata

Evolutionary Relationship

Peters's Ghost-faced Bat and Slender Ground-hopper share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
